Factors to Consider When Choosing a Dash Cam With Good Night Vision
When you’re choosing a dash cam with strong night vision, you’ll want to evaluate several key factors. The image sensor quality and night vision technology play an essential role in low-light performance, while a wide dynamic range helps capture details in varying light conditions. Don’t forget to look into aperture size and video resolution, as these can greatly impact the clarity of your recordings.
Image Sensor Quality
Choosing a dash cam with exceptional night vision hinges on the quality of its image sensor. Advanced sensors like the Sony STARVIS series excel in low-light conditions, ensuring clear footage when you need it most. Look for lenses with higher aperture values, such as F1.5 or F1.8; these allow more light to enter, enhancing clarity during nighttime drives. Additionally, Wide Dynamic Range (WDR) technology balances lighting in scenes with both bright and dark areas, preventing overexposure or underexposure. If you often find yourself in complete darkness, consider a dash cam with infrared (IR) lamps for added illumination. Finally, higher image resolutions, measured in megapixels, contribute to sharper and more discernible images, ensuring you capture every detail.

Wide Dynamic Range
To capture clear footage in varying lighting conditions, Wide Dynamic Range (WDR) technology is a vital feature to look for in a dash cam. WDR enhances video quality by adjusting exposure levels, guaranteeing you get clear images in both bright sunlight and dark shadows. This technology reduces overexposure in glaring light and underexposure in dim areas, providing a balanced image that reveals essential details. Dash cams with WDR use advanced algorithms to merge multiple exposures into one optimized frame, boosting clarity and contrast. When combined with high-quality night vision features, such as infrared lights, WDR guarantees your dash cam performs effectively during nighttime or low-light driving, giving you peace of mind on the road.
Aperture Size Importance
When it comes to capturing clear footage in low-light situations, the aperture size of a dash cam plays an important role. A larger aperture, like F1.5 or F1.8, allows more light into the lens, greatly improving visibility. This means you’ll get clearer images, making it easier to identify vital details like license plates and road signs at night. Conversely, dash cams with smaller apertures often produce grainy footage, which can hinder their effectiveness in capturing significant evidence during nighttime incidents. When you’re selecting a dash cam, consider the aperture size alongside advanced sensor technology, such as STARVIS, to guarantee reliable performance in various lighting conditions. This combination will optimize light intake and minimize motion blur for your night driving needs.

Recording Angle Coverage
Choosing a dash cam with a wide recording angle, ideally between 170° to 180°, is vital for thorough road coverage. This minimizes blind spots, ensuring you capture everything happening around your vehicle. If you want the best protection, consider multi-channel dash cams with 4-channel systems, giving you 360° coverage. This setup captures video from the front, rear, and sides simultaneously, enhancing your situational awareness. The ability to switch between different camera angles, like front and rear or interior views, can also be important for documenting incidents effectively. Plus, higher resolution options, such as 4K recording, provide clearer images, making it easier to identify significant details. Adjustable camera mounts allow you to customize your viewing angle for ideal recording performance.
Storage Capacity Options
Understanding storage capacity is just as important as having a wide recording angle when selecting a dash cam, especially for those looking for exceptional night vision. Aim for models that support at least 64GB memory cards, which typically allow for ample continuous recording without frequent overwriting. If you plan long trips, consider dash cams that offer expandable storage options, letting you upgrade to cards as large as 256GB or 512GB. Look for loop recording features, which automatically overwrite the oldest footage, ensuring you always have the latest recordings. If you choose a dash cam with a pre-installed memory card, check its capacity. Remember, high-resolution recordings like 4K will fill your storage faster, so opt for higher capacity for peak performance.

How Do Night Vision Technologies Differ Among Dash Cams?
Night vision technologies in dash cams vary mainly in sensor quality, aperture size, and infrared capabilities. Some use advanced sensors for clearer images in low light, while others rely on basic infrared for visibility.
